had a discussion today and someone said they would not use a clutch fan cause they cause overheating at prolonged low speeds

I thought it was a temp controlled spring type to engage the fan or does it have to be up to a certain RPM?

guy was not a cruiser guy so he might be off base but it got me wondering if a straight drive fan was preferable
 
Clutch fan works fine all day at a crawl. No issues.
 
I wheel in AZ any time of the year, yes, the clutch fan does a fine job

I have an auxiliary electric pusher fan, but usually I do not need it while wheeling/crawling, but on the highway at sustained high speeds in the dead heat of summer
